Lightweight CNC e-cross QS165, ND72360.

hetm4n 

Welcome, I present my construction made completely from scratch. It is an electric cross with MIDDRIVE motor. The geometry is similar to the surron. Frame drawn in Corel and milled from 7075 aerospace aluminium on CNC router (10mm body, 20mm swingarm).

Fardriver ND72360 controller (190A/360A-13kWmax) currently set to 120A/240A
Motor QS165 47Nm + gear from surron + rear sprocket 58T.
